| Opis awersu | On the left is the small State Emblem of Ukraine. In the center sriblyanyk - one of the first coins that were minted in the Kievan state, under it - a fragment of ancient Kyiv (used local gilding) with names of local tribes on sides. |
|---|---|
| Pismo awersu | Cyrillic |
| Legenda awersu | 2015 20 ГРИВЕНЬ УКРАЇНА КИЇВСЬКA РУСЬ Ятваги Ижора Весь Кривичі Водь Мера Дреговичі Мурома Древляни Словени Поляни Ільменські Колиняни Ватичi Хорвати Радимичі Уличі Сіверяни Тиверці (Translation: 20 Hryven Ukraine Kievan Rus, Yatvagi, Izhora, Vesj, Krivichss, Vodj, Mera, Dregovichs, Muroma, Drevlyans, Slovens, Polans, Ilmenski, Kolinyani, Vyatichs, White Croats, Radimichs, Ulichs, Severians, Tivertsi.) |
| Opis rewersu | In the center - Kiev Prince Volodymyr the Great (used local gilding) which holds in one hand a cross, the second - the layout of the house; located around four medallions with stylized images of acts of state-Prince, coinage, joining new territories and protection of state borders, economic development and trade, baptism population and establishment of Christianity as the state religion. |
| Pismo rewersu | Cyrillic |
| Legenda rewersu | КИЇВСЬКИЙ КНЯЗЬ, ВОЛОДИМИР ВЕЛИКИЙ (Translation: Kyiv prince Volodymyr the Great) |
